The Honey Foundation is a 501(c) 3 non-profit organization that believes the world benefits through kindness. The foundation is all about making the world a better place by promoting random acts of kindness and paying kindness forward. The Honey Foundation partners with schools to provide and broaden a child’s horizons by performing random acts of kindness, delivering life skills, and by showing them that the smallest gesture can make the day for another person.

Survival Swim was founded because of my passion for teaching others how to swim and survive in the water. During my 15 plus years of teaching private swim lessons, I am constantly reminded that drowning is the second most leading cause of death in children ages 1-14. At Survival Swim, we believe swimming is lots of fun but, you have to learn to swim first if you want to enjoy the water. Swimming is a survival skill that you have to learn first in order to Swim Safe & Survive in the water.Survival Swim is a mobile, private swim instruction company. We come to you. Our instructors provide early to advanced level swim instruction, at your personal residence, community pool, or a Survival Swim “Guest Home” pool near you. Survival Swim can teach swimmers of all ages; from babies six months old, new swimmers young and old, special needs, and advanced skill technique training for elite swimmers.www.survival-swim.com
